当前位置: 首页 > 知识库问答 >
问题:

如何将Oracle高级队列与Websphere 7.0集成

墨翔宇
2023-03-14

IBM Websphere文档表明可以使用第三方jms提供者:http://pic.dhe.ibm.com/infocenter/wasinfo/v6r1/index.jsp?topic =/com . IBM . WebSphere . nd . doc/info/AE/AE/TMJ _ instp . html

在oracle文件夹中,我发现了资源适配器ojms.rar,但如何使用它?也许有人用WAS7对付AQ?

共有3个答案

平光明
2023-03-14

如果您仍在寻找答案,请按照以下步骤使用ojms.rar安装资源适配器

遗憾的是,“ojms.rar”不包含安装所需的类。

下载mqjra。rar,提取并取出gjra。jar

将< code>gjra.jar放在您的< code >中

尝试使用 ojms 安装资源适配器.rar

它将被安装。如果遇到问题,请还原。

裴星洲
2023-03-14

我最近尝试将 Websphere 与 Oracle AQ 集成,并找到了一个有效的解决方案。我已经在博客中解释了如何做到这一点。http://itsolutionsarchitect.blogspot.com/

如果您仍在尝试使其工作,请告诉我这是否有帮助。

华欣荣
2023-03-14

我自己没有使用过OracleAQ,但这里有指向文档的链接;由于AQ与JCA兼容,您可以从管理与第三方JCA 1.5兼容的消息传递提供程序的消息开始。此配置的第一步是安装资源适配器(ohms.rar)。

另外,为了完整起见,让我补充一点,您也可以使用 WebSphere 适配器访问 AQ。在这种情况下,您不将 AQ 配置为 JMS 提供程序,而是使用 IBM 备用适配器访问 AQ,AQ 充当 AQ 的客户端,并以符合 JCA 的方式向应用程序公开 AQ 服务。有关此替代方案的更多信息,请参阅 Oracle 电子商务套件的 WebSphere 适配器的教育助手。

 类似资料:
  • 多读者/Tag createTag() deleteTag() listTag() getTagInfo() 死信队列 setQueueRedrivePolicy() removeQueueRedrivePolicy() 从死信队列中接收消息 向死信队列发送消息 多读者/Tag相关 Topic Queue Priority Queue

  • 问题内容: 在Python文档中, 最低值的条目首先被检索(最低值的条目是由返回的条目)。条目的典型模式是形式为的元组。 看来队列将按优先级排序,然后按数据排序,这可能并不总是正确的。假设数据“项目2”在“项目1”之前入队,则项目1仍将排在第一位。在另一个文档页面heapq中,它建议使用计数器。所以我将数据存储为。是否没有类似的东西 那我就不需要自己执行订购吗? 问题答案: 据我所知,您要找的东西

  • 我想通过JMS使用Oracle高级队列。 我已经通过plsql创建队列表和队列如下: 然后我试着发出这样的信息: 上面的代码找到了队列(如果我将Q3替换为其他内容,那么它会显示queue not found,所以我想基本的连接设置是可以的),但我在producer得到了NPE异常。邮寄我设置了aqapi跟踪,得到了以下输出: 我反编译了aqapi.jar,发现NPE被抛出,因为“adtType”参

  • 我需要一个优先级队列,它首先获得具有最高优先级值的项目。我当前正在使用队列库中的PriorityQueue类。但是,这个函数只先返回值最小的项。我尝试了一些很难看的解决方案,比如(sys.maxint-priority)作为优先级,但我只是想知道是否存在更优雅的解决方案。

  • 主要内容:Stream 概述,2 Stream基本结构,3 存储数据,3.1 Entry ID,3.2 数量限制,4 获取数据,4.1 范围查询,4.2 独立消费消息,4.3 消费者组,5 永久故障恢复,5.1 XPENDING查看未处理消息,5.2 XCLAIM转移消息,5.3 XAUTOCLAIM自动转移,6 死信队列,7 Stream监控,8 删除消息,9 零长度Stream,10 ACK确认,11 总结详细介绍了 Redis 5.0 版本新增加的数据结构Stream的使用方式以及原理,如

  • 我有以下代码: 如您所见,我需要将< code >流的元素收集到< code >队列中,而不是< code >列表中。但是,没有< code > collectors . to queue()方法。如何将元素收集到< code >队列中?